The nearest major airports for your trip to Koishi

To visit Koishi, Sarufutsu in Hokkaido, you can fly into Wakkanai Airport (WKJ), located 22.5km away. Recommended hotels nearby include the 3.5-star Surfeel Hotel Wakkanai and Hotel Meguma, both within 6 and 3.2km, respectively. Another option is the Dormy Inn Wakkanai Natural Hot Spring, also 9.7km from the airport. Alternatively, Rishiri Airport (RIS) is 43.2km from Koishi, with notable hotels such as the Island Inn Rishiri and Tanakaya Hinageshikan, both within 5 and 3.2km respectively, offering limited transportation services. Rishiri Fuji Kanko Hotel, also 3.2km from RIS, provides a free airport shuttle service for added convenience.

What's the weather like in Koishi?

The hottest months are usually August and July, with an average temperature of 17°C, while the coldest months are February and January, with an average of -3°C. The snowiest months in Koishi are March, January, February and December, with each month seeing an average of 249 cm of snowfall.
